15/00867/HOU - 223 Markfield Road, Groby PDF 53 KB Application for erection of garage/shed and 4-bay dog kennel (retrospective). Minutes: Application for erection of garage/shed and 4 bay dog kennel (retrospective).
Notwithstanding the officer’s recommendation that the application be approved, Councillor Cartwright proposed refusal on the grounds of proximity and adverse impact on neighbours through noise disturbance, not being in keeping with the property, being oversized, not, in his opinion, being for domestic use and the inadequate highways access. This motion was seconded by Councillor Hollick.
Before being taken to a vote, further discussion followed with members of the opinion that the committee would benefit from a site visit and therefore Councillor O’shea proposed a deferral on the matter to make an informed decision. Councillor Bill seconded this motion. Councillors Cartwright and Hollick, content with the proposal to defer, withdrew their motion to refuse the application.
Upon being put to the vote it was unanimously
RESOLVED – the application be deferred for a site visit. |

15/00827/FUL - Land North East of Reservoir Road, Thornton PDF 94 KB Conversion and extension of agricultural building for stables, formation of ménage, improvements to existing access, hard surfaced parking and turning area and change of use of land for the keeping of horses. Minutes: Application for the conversion and extension of agricultural building for stables, formation of ménage, improvements to existing access, hard surfaced parking and turning area and change of use of land for the keeping of horses.
Notwithstanding the officer’s recommendation that the application be approved, Councillor O’Shea proposed refusal on the grounds of the intrusion and overbearing nature the application would have on the countryside and the detriment to highway safety. Councillor Cartwright seconded Councillor O’Shea’s proposal and upon being put to the vote this motion was LOST.
It was then moved by Councillor Sutton and seconded by Councillor Hodgkins that the application be approved. Cllr Roberts, seconded by Councillor O’shea moved an amendment that a condition be added to require removal of the concrete base. The amendment, being accepted by the mover and seconder, was put to the vote and subsequently CARRIED and it was
RESOLVED – the application be approved subject to the conditions contained officer’s report and an amended condition requiring the removal of the concrete base. |

15/00951/OUT - Merrifield House, Merrifield Gardens, Burbage PDF 116 KB Demolition of existing buildings and erection of 7 dwellings (outline – all matters reserved). Minutes: Application for demolition of existing buildings and erection of 7 dwellings (outline – all matters reserved).
It was moved by Councillor Rooney and seconded by Councillor Allen that the application be approved. Upon being put to the vote there were 6 votes FOR the motion and 6 votes AGAINST, the Chairman therefore exercised his right to have a casting vote under Council Procedure Rule 18.2 and voted AGAINST the motion which was therefore declared LOST.
Members were concerned about the access and layout of the site and it was moved by Councillor Taylor and seconded by Councillor Cartwright that the matter be deferred. Upon being put to the vote the motion was declared CARRIED and
RESOLVED – the application be deferred.
